💻

Github

`gh` CLI를 사용해 터미널에서 GitHub와 상호작용 — 이슈, 풀 리퀘스트, CI 실행 및 고급 API 쿼리를 관리합니다.

Peter Steinbergerv1.0.0
Coding Agents & IDEsProductivityOpen SourceAutomationCLIDeveloper Tool
VM에 연결 중...
VM에 연결 중...
npx clawhub@latest install github
101현재 설치 수
1.5k누적 설치 수
v1.0.0버전

GitHub 스킬은 gh CLI의 모든 기능을 워크플로에 가져옵니다. 풀 리퀘스트 생성 및 검토, CI 파이프라인 실행 모니터링, 이슈 나열 및 분류, 원시 GitHub API 호출 — 이 모든 것을 터미널을 떠나지 않고 수행할 수 있습니다.

작동 원리

1

Step 1

한 번 인증
gh auth login이 자격 증명을 안전하게 저장하고 이후 모든 명령에서 자동으로 사용됩니다.
2

Step 2

임의 저장소 대상 지정
git 디렉터리 밖에서 실행할 때 --repo owner/repo를 추가하거나 GitHub URL을 전달합니다.
3

Step 3

하위 명령 사용
gh issue, gh pr, gh run, gh api가 가장 일반적인 GitHub 워크플로를 커버합니다.
4

Step 4

JQ로 필터링
--json 출력을 --jq 표현식으로 파이프하여 필요한 데이터를 정확하게 추출합니다.

주요 기능

풀 리퀘스트 관리
목록 확인, 조회, CI 상태 확인, 개별 PR 세부 정보 검사.
CI/CD 모니터링
워크플로 실행 목록 확인, 실패한 단계 검사, 터미널에서 직접 로그 스트리밍.
고급 API 액세스
gh api를 사용하여 표준 하위 명령으로 노출되지 않는 데이터를 위해 모든 GitHub REST 엔드포인트에 액세스.
구조화된 JSON 출력
모든 명령이 기계 판독 가능하고 필터링 가능한 결과를 위해 --json--jq를 지원.
추가 자격 증명 불필요
인증은 gh CLI에 의해 완전히 처리되므로 API 키나 토큰을 별도로 관리할 필요가 없습니다.

요구 사항

gh CLI
cli.github.com에서 설치하고 첫 사용 전에 gh auth login으로 인증하세요.

활용 사례

코드 리뷰 워크플로
병합 전에 풀 리퀘스트에서 어떤 CI 검사가 실패하는지 빠르게 확인합니다.
CI 실패 디버깅
GitHub Web UI를 열지 않고도 실패한 워크플로 단계의 로그를 가져옵니다.
Issue 분류
사용자 지정 JSON 필터로 열린 이슈를 나열하여 스크립트나 보고서에 입력합니다.
API 자동화
더 큰 자동화 파이프라인의 일부로 GitHub REST 엔드포인트(PR 메타데이터, 레이블, 리뷰어)를 쿼리합니다.

설치 방법

1
Run in your terminal
npx clawhub@latest install github
or
2
Click the Install button at the top of this page for one-click setup

자주 묻는 질문

리뷰

0개 리뷰

리뷰를 작성하려면 로그인

아직 리뷰가 없습니다. 첫 번째로 경험을 공유해 보세요!